Woman Ages Backwards in Online Writing Class, Still Loses to 21-Year-Old

KEY POINTS

  • A woman met a 21-year-younger friend in an online writing class spanning New York and Chicago over three years.
  • Initially jealous of the younger woman's discipline and flawless skin, she later embraced her age inspired by a viral Instagram meme.
  • Their friendship evolved into a reciprocal mentorship, blending candid talks of graduate school, relationships, and existential middle-age crises.

In a friendship that’s part intergenerational therapy, part skincare envy, a woman found herself obsessing over the porcelain, wrinkle-free skin and perfect curls of her 21-years-younger writing class partner. Meeting online for weekly emotional overshares between New York and Chicago, they spilled more secrets than a true crime doc. She envied disciplined grad-school applications while regretting her own wild, booze-soaked past of kissing boys and smoking cigs. Then, an Instagram meme hit her harder than her creaking knees: 'Make 25-year-olds excited to be 40,' shifting her mindset from jealous Aunt Karen to role model. Twice-divorced but proudly boyfriend-flashing, she learned mentorship is a two-way street, with candid talks on sexual compliance and family drama making her rethink her 'middle-aged resignation.' Forget wrinkles—this duo’s friendship made aging look like a plot twist, not a cliffhanger.
